Send linux system reports & security alerts via Telegram.

System reports

This utility can generate and send system summary reports. Run with the --send-report flag.

Security alerts

Listens to changes in /var/log/auth.log and detects failed attempts to log in the machine. Run with the --listen-auth-log flag.

⚠️📢 May 10 00:16:29 debian sshd[1386]: Invalid user unknown-user from 10.0.2.2 port 10484

Requirements

Python 3 >= version specified in runtime.txt

Usage

Set the following environment variables. You can set these variables creating a .env file; check .env.example.

  • TELEGRAM_BOT_AUTHENTICATION_TOKEN: authentication token of the desired Telegram bot. You don't have one?
  • TELEGRAM_SECURITY_ALERTS_TARGET: target of the security alerts.
  • TELEGRAM_SYSTEM_REPORTS_TARGET: target of the system reports.

Install requirements.txt dependencies and run monitor.py with the desired flag.

usage: monitor.py [-h] [--send-report] [--listen-auth-log]

System monitoring via Telegram

optional arguments:
  -h, --help         show this help message and exit
  --send-report      sends week use summary to TELEGRAM_SYSTEM_MONITORING_TARGET
  --listen-auth-log  listens to authentication errors on /var/log/auth.log and sends reports to TELEGRAM_SECURITY_ALERTS_TARGET
